Preferably, determine the loss information of the strainer in vehicle operation include: according to real time data it is determining with it is multiple pre- The corresponding multiple air quality informations of section of fixing time;According to multiple air quality informations, determining and multiple predetermined amount of time Information is lost in corresponding multiple segmentations, wherein segmentation loss information is used to indicate the damage of strainer within a predetermined period of time Consumption;And the loss information of strainer is determined according to multiple segmentation loss information.
Specifically, firstly, server 210 determines the corresponding multiple skies of multiple predetermined amount of time according to real time data Gas quality information.For example, multiple predetermined amount of time can be according to the time span pre-set period, for example every 10 minutes it is One predetermined amount of time every 20 minutes is a predetermined amount of time.In addition, in the relatively good area of air quality or season Section, the time span of multiple predetermined amount of time can be set longer, can be 30 minutes or longer.Compare in air quality Difference area or season, the time span of multiple predetermined amount of time can be set it is shorter, can be 3 minutes, 5 minutes or It is shorter.Each predetermined amount of time has corresponding air quality detecting device 240 air quality information detected.
Then, server 210 determines that multiple predetermined amount of time are multiple points corresponding according to multiple air quality informations Section loss information.For example, server 210 determines the 1st predetermined amount of time t1Corresponding air quality information is q1(for example, can be with It is PM2.5 concentration in air in vehicle).And server 210 is according to identified air quality information q1, further determine that with Predetermined amount of time t1Information h is lost in corresponding segmentation1.Information h is lost in the segmentation1It indicates in predetermined amount of time t1It is interior, the damage of strainer Consume situation.In a like fashion to 210 benefit of server, determining and multiple predetermined amount of time t1~tnAir quality information q1 ~qnInformation h is lost in corresponding multiple segmentations1~hn
Finally, server 210 determines the loss information of strainer according to multiple segmentation loss information.For example, server 210 According to identified multiple predetermined amount of time t1~tnInformation h is lost in corresponding multiple segmentations1~hn, determine the loss information of strainer.
In general, the air quality in vehicle is a dynamic value.Just it is by the concentration of the PM2.5 in air in vehicle Example, the concentration of the PM2.5 in vehicle in air is usually different in different times.Therefore pass through methods described above, It calculates segmentation corresponding with multiple predetermined amount of time and information is lost, and determine the damage of strainer according to calculated segmentation loss information Information is consumed, the loss of strainer can be relatively accurately determined, to mention in the case where the air quality in vehicle is dynamic value The high accuracy of judgement.
Preferably, the behaviour of multiple air quality informations corresponding with multiple predetermined amount of time is determined according to real time data Make, comprising: obtain real time data corresponding with each predetermined amount of time;Determine the flat of the real time data in each predetermined amount of time Mean value, and using average value as air quality information corresponding with each predetermined amount of time.
Specifically, server 210 obtains the corresponding real time data of each predetermined amount of time.For example, server 210 is got I-th of predetermined amount of time tiCorresponding real time data is d respectivelyi1、di2、di3…dik.Then server 210 calculates real time data di1~dikAverage value as predetermined amount of time tiAir quality information qi.To adopt in a like fashion, server 210 determine each predetermined amount of time t1~tnCorresponding air quality information q1~qn
In this way, so that the air quality information according to determined by real time data of server 210 can be more reflected in The actual conditions of air quality in the predetermined amount of time make calculated result more accurately react the actual loss feelings of strainer Condition.

Preferably, the operation of the loss information of the strainer is determined according to multiple segmentation loss information, comprising: by multiple points Section loss information summation, to obtain the loss information of strainer.
Specifically, server 210 corresponds to air quality information according to multiple predetermined amount of time and finds multiple segmentation loss letters Breath, and ask the sum of multiple segmentation loss information, as the loss information of strainer.For example, multiple air quality informations are q respectively1 ~qn, corresponding segmentation loss information is h respectively1~hn.So loss information H=h of the strainer1+h2+……+hn
Preferably, according to loss information, it is determined whether need replacing the operation of the strainer, comprising: will loss information with Pre-set threshold value comparison;And in the case where information is lost greater than threshold value, determination needs replacing the strainer.
Specifically, the loss information of 210 pairs of server calculating is compared with pre-set threshold value, if loss information Greater than threshold value, illustrate the strainer replacement.For example, 210 computed losses information of server is H, by H and threshold comparison, if H Illustrate that strainer can also continue to using if in the case that H is greater than or equal to threshold value, illustrating that strainer needs more less than threshold value It changes, server 210 judges that the strainer needs replacing.
Server 210 needs replacing strainer by judging whether compared with threshold value.Because of the corresponding mistake of different strainers Filter ability is different, so corresponding different using the time.By this method, according to the different filter capacities of strainer, setting The size of threshold value.Keep this method application range more extensively and flexible.
